In a week that saw four area baseball teams and two local softball squads advance into the semifinals of the CIF Central Section Playoffs, 10 candidates have emerged for the Times area Player of the Week honor for the week ending May 20.
Readers can vote for one of the candidates online all week at santamariatimes.com, lompocrecord.com and syvnews.com. The poll will close at 2 p.m. Friday and the winner will be announced in Saturday's edition of the Santa Maria Times. Votes submitted after that time will not be counted.
